J282 UNT is a 1991 Fiat Ducato in White with a 1,929c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.6%.
Across all 1991 Fiat Ducato models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.5% with a typical mileage of 82,806 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Ducato f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 34,174 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J282 UNT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Ducato typ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 35 years old, this Fiat Ducato is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
